After 3 1/2 years and over 6000 volunteer hours ....
FS Route 3N93 Holcomb Creek is OPEN!

Pick up a Sidekick Off Road map from the Discovery Center for $3. The trail is well marked on the map. But don't follow he yellow line of their "self-guided tour". Stay on 3N93 all the way. If you go off on 2N06X like the map says, you'll miss the best part of the trail.
